Aplikacije, naložene stransko zunaj trgovine z aplikacijami, ne bodo mogle dostopati do poslušalca obvestil v sistemu Android 13. Berite naprej, če želite izvedeti več.
Google uvaja spremembo z Android 13 to bo preprečite, da bi stransko naložene aplikacije zlorabile API-je za dostopnost. Funkcija omejenih nastavitev bo uporabniku preprečila omogočanje storitve dostopnosti za zlonamerne aplikacije. Ko prepoznate takšno aplikacijo, bodo nastavitve dostopnosti za to aplikacijo postale nedostopne, uporabniki pa bodo videli pogovorno okno »Omejena nastavitev«, v katerem je navedeno, da nastavitev trenutno ni na voljo. Toda to še ni vse, kar je v novi funkciji.
Po besedah Mishaala Rahmana bo funkcija omejenih nastavitev tudi blokirala uporabnike pri omogočanju poslušalca obvestil aplikacije. Za tiste, ki ne vedo, Androidov NotificationListenerService API omogoča aplikacijam prestrezanje in interakcijo z vsemi obvestili v imenu uporabnika. Če zlonamerna aplikacija dobi dostop do API-ja, lahko prebere vsa dohodna obvestila in pridobi dostop do občutljivih informacij. Funkcija omejenih nastavitev Androida 13 to preprečuje za vse aplikacije, naložene stransko z namestitvenim programom za pakete, ki ne temelji na seji.
Ker večina trgovin z aplikacijami uporablja namestitveni program paketov, ki temelji na seji, ta omejitev ne velja za aplikacije, prenesene iz trgovin z aplikacijami. Blokirala bo le aplikacije, ki jih uporabniki naložijo zunaj trgovin z aplikacijami, na primer prek brskalnika ali aplikacije za sporočanje. Vendar pa obstaja rešitev, s katero preprečite, da bi funkcija blokirala dostop stransko naloženim aplikacijam.
Rahman ugotavlja, da je "možno je potrditi pogovorno okno z omejenimi nastavitvami in nato znova omogočiti dostop" na nastavitve dostopnosti. Več o rešitvi lahko izveste v ta objava v spletnem dnevniku.
Avtorstvo predstavljene slike: Mishaal Rahman